With two exceptional EP’s released under her new moniker Vetta Borne, Melbourne based Maribelle Añes, returns with her latest offeringRose Avenue Vol .1’, out now via Soul Modern.

The EP follows on from the release of Violeta in 2020, and Emelia in 2021, making her one of the most prolific and exciting producer-singer-multiinstrumentalists the country has to offer.

 

Whilst the former EPs were a means of exploring her new identity whilst paying homage to her influential grandmothers, ‘Rose Avenue Vol. 1 sees Vetta Borne burst right out her shell.

Sonically, the production is another jaw dropping example of Vetta Borne’s undeniable expertise as a producer having created the whole project from start to finish in her bedroom studio, displaying her multifaceted talents sampling various drums, whilst laying down her own smooth electric guitar, bass, and synth lines throughout.

 

Whilst lyrically, Vetta Borne displays her vulnerability as the project deep dives into the heartbreak at the end of the relationship, with each track representing the various stages of grief, and coming to terms with the personal loss of connection.
